[Remote] Manager Quality Engineering

Remote Full-time
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. RELX Inc. is a global provider of information-based analytics and decision tools for professional and business customers. They are seeking a Manager of Quality Engineering to lead Quality Assurance/Testing efforts, ensuring the successful delivery of high-quality software products and services. This role involves collaborating with various teams, implementing processes for efficient delivery, and managing continuous improvement initiatives.ResponsibilitiesLead Quality Assurance/Testing for a defined area of responsibility to successfully and consistently deliver high-quality software products and services on time, on budget, and to specificationInteract with Product Management, Project Management, Engineering, and Operations teams to plan delivery of products and enhancements and to assure products meet requirements and quality standardsImplement processes that enable efficient delivery and maintenanceBalance deployment of resources within group as necessary to support prioritiesIdentify opportunities for automation or other utilities and work within the framework of the QA/Test team to fulfill these needsImplement and cooperate in the enhancement of the methodologies employed for test planning and execution, defect tracking, and metric and status reportingManage continuous improvement initiatives and implementation of best practicesIdentify areas for cooperation and, with peers or others, implement initiatives improving overall capability and efficiencyLead or participate in initiatives to identify and implement tools and utilities that enhance testing capabilities and product qualityWork with QA/Testing staff, project managers, technical leads, and subject matter experts to plan and execute automated and performance testsEnsure that testing addresses requirements as agreed with other stakeholdersWork with architects, developers, and network and system engineers to research and identify root causes of performance issuesServe as subject matter expert in the configuration, maintenance, and/or administration of testing tools or environmentsSuggest process improvements that enable efficient delivery and maintenance with consistent directionMaintain flexibility to react quickly to changes in priorities or circumstances to meet the needs of the businessReport issues and results, researching and identifying root causes as appropriate, documenting accordinglyMaintain awareness of the state of the industry and evaluate emerging trends/developments that may benefit the organizationConduct project reviews, ensuring review criteria are defined, and implement procedures for ensuring quality control of project deliverablesCarry out management responsibilities in accordance with the organization’s policies, procedures, and applicable lawsResponsibilities include interviewing, hiring, and training employees; plan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ance; rewarding and disciplining employees; and addressing complaints and resolving problemsEnsure all staff is provided with training and resources needed to perform their jobs to the most outstanding degree possibleEnsure all staff is provided with frequent feedback and coaching in order to meet and exceed individual and team performance goals consistentlyManage and encourage new ideas from staff to foster improvements through innovationsEmpower the staff to be accountable and responsible for their own actions and decisionsPerform other duties as neededSkillsBachelor's degree (or foreign equivalent) in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Systems, Information Technology or a related field required5 years of experience in job offered or related occupations required5 years of experience: in test strategy and test management including test planning, test case design, test lifecycle management, defect tracking, traceability matrices, release gating, and quality metrics/reporting using Xray, JIRA, Confluence, Version 1, HP ALM; building test automation and framework design, including development and maintenance of reusable automated test frameworks for web, mobile and API testing using C#/Java and integration of automation into CI/CD pipelines using industry standard tool like Selenium, Playwright, TestNG, JUnit, NUnit, RestAssured, RestSharp, Groovy, PostMan Cucumber; CI: Jenkins, GitHub Actions, GitLab CI; performance, scalability and reliability testing, including planning and executing load/stress tests, capacity planning, bottleneck identification and root-cause analysis in collaboration with architects and engineers using industry standard tools like JMeter, LoadRunner and building performance dashboard using AWS Grafana and OpenSearch; maintaining, administering and automating test environments and infrastructure to support scalable, repeatable testing and rapid delivery; and scripting, tooling and quality engineering leadership, including development of automation utilities and test tooling, API and security testing, process improvement and mentoring/hiring/training QA staff while driving cross-functional collaboration and continuous improvement using Groovy/Python, Postman/SOAPUI, Agile/SAFe, Dual ScrumBenefitsStandard company benefitsCountry specific benefitsWe are committed to providing a fair and accessible hiring process.
